Understanding Centerless Grinders
Centerless grinders are essential tools in the manufacturing sector, primarily used for shaping and finishing parts without the need to align them centering. Unlike traditional cylindrical grinders, centerless grinders hold workpieces between two wheels—a grinding wheel and a regulating wheel. This setup allows for a continuous and efficient grinding process, as parts can be fed into the grinder without the need for manual repositioning. The design is particularly useful for producing high volumes of cylindrical parts, making it ideal for industries such as automotive, aerospace, and medical devices.
The Importance of CE Certification
With the increasing globalization of manufacturing, securing CE certification is more important than ever for companies looking to sell their products within the European market. The certification assures both manufacturers and customers that the equipment adheres to EU regulations, providing a level of safety assurance to end-users. For centerless grinders, CE certification involves rigorous testing and evaluation to guarantee they are designed and manufactured in such a way that their operational risks are minimized.
When a centerless grinder is CE certified, it signifies that the equipment has been evaluated for conformity with applicable directives, including mechanical safety, electromagnetic compatibility, and noise emission standards. This certification not only enhances the appeal of the product in Europe but also boosts the reputation of the manufacturer as a responsible and quality-oriented entity.
